T18 OSH is a 2000 Citroen Saxo in Blue with a 1,124c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 4 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2000 Citroen Saxo models, the average MOT pass rate is 63.8% with a typical mileage of 67,518 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Citroen Saxo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 130,935 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T18 OSH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Saxo typ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 26 years old, this Citroen Saxo is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
